2x + x = 4(y - 1)
(Solving for slope and y-intercept)

Answer:

Equation: y = 3/4(x) + 1

Slope: 3/4

Y-intercept: 1

Explanation:

1. How do we solve this problem?

  • To find the slope and y-intercept, we should first isolate the variable, y, on one side to make it easier to find.

Step 1: Simplify both sides of the equation.


  • (2x + x) = (4)(y) + (4)(-1)

  • 3x = 4y - 4

Step 2: Flip the equation.


  • 4y - 4 = 3x

Step 3: Add 4 to both sides.


  • 4y - 4 + 4 = 3x + 4

  • 4y = 3x + 4

Step 4: Divide both sides by 4.


  • (4y)/(4) = (3x+4)/(4)

  • y = (3)/(4)x + 1

2. Now, the y-intercept form of an equation goes like this: y = mx + b, where y = y-coordinate, m = slope, x = x-coordinate, and b = y-intercept. In the place of m, the slope is 3/4. In the place of b, the y-intercept is 1.
